A spreadsheet program file often utilized for determining the appropriate number of participants or observations needed for research or statistical analysis. This type of file typically includes built-in formulas and functions that allow users to input key parameters, such as desired confidence level, margin of error, and population size (if known), to generate a recommended sample size. An example would be a researcher using such a file to determine how many individuals should be surveyed for a market research study.

Determining an adequate number of participants is crucial for obtaining statistically significant results and drawing valid conclusions. An insufficient number can lead to inaccurate or misleading findings, while an unnecessarily large number can waste resources and time. Historically, researchers relied on manual calculations and statistical tables. Modern spreadsheet software offers a more efficient and accessible method, streamlining the process and reducing the risk of errors.

Determining the number of participants required for research using the R programming language involves statistical methods to ensure reliable results. For example, a researcher studying the effectiveness of a new drug might use R to determine how many patients are needed to confidently detect a specific improvement. Various packages within R, such as `pwr` and `samplesize`, provide functions for these calculations, accommodating different study designs and statistical tests.

Accurate determination of participant numbers is crucial for research validity and resource efficiency. An insufficient number can lead to inconclusive results, while an excessive number wastes resources. Historically, manual calculations were complex and time-consuming. The development of statistical software like R has streamlined this process, allowing researchers to easily explore various scenarios and optimize their studies for power and precision. This accessibility has broadened the application of rigorous sample size planning across diverse research fields.

A tool used in statistical analysis determines the minimum number of participants required to confidently demonstrate that a new treatment or intervention is not substantially worse than an existing standard treatment by a pre-specified margin. For example, a researcher might use this tool to determine how many patients are needed to show that a new drug for hypertension is not significantly less effective than a current market leader.

Determining the appropriate number of participants is critical for the validity and reliability of research findings. An insufficient sample size can lead to inaccurate conclusions, while an excessively large sample size can be wasteful of resources. This methodology helps researchers strike a balance between statistical power and practical feasibility. Historically, ensuring adequate sample size has been a cornerstone of robust clinical trials and research studies across various fields, supporting evidence-based decision-making in healthcare, engineering, and other disciplines.
